Gloria J. (Cassista) Nestor, 85

Whitinsville - Gloria J. (Cassista) Nestor, 85, died Monday, November 30. She is survived by five sons; Gary and his wife Cheryl, of Northbridge, Michael and his wife Lucille, of Virginia Beach, Timothy and his wife Diane, of Virginia Beach, Steven and his wife Lori, of Sutton, Scott and his wife Lisa of Uxbridge; a daughter Susan Demers and her husband Wayne, of Sutton; a sister, Faye Storey, of Uxbridge and sister-in-law Helen Lucier, of Auburn; 14 grandchildren and 5 great grandchildren. Mrs. Nestor was predeceased by her husband, Patrick J. Nestor, Jr. in 1990, her son Patrick in 1967, her sister Barbara Jones in 2004, and a grandson T.J.

A daughter of Adelard and Emma (Guyan) Cassista, she was born October 5, 1930 in Douglas, graduated from Douglas High School in 1949 and moved to Whitinsville in 1959. She had lived in Rockdale for the past 5 years. Mrs. Nestor worked at the former Telechron in Ashland, the Trading Post and Village Variety before retiring.

She was a member of St. Patrick's Church and, most recently, St. Peter's Church. Mrs. Nestor was a voracious reader. She especially enjoyed time spent with her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ren. Her family always came first.

Mrs. Nestor's Memorial Mass will be Thursday, December 10 at 11AM, in St. Peter's Church, Northbridge. Burial will follow in St. Patrick's Cemetery. There are no calling hours. Please omit flowers. Memorial donations may be made to the Bereavement Committee at St. Peter's Church, PO Box 446, Northbridge, MA 01534.
